Avery Sunshine
Avery Sunshine has a unique style that blends R&B with soul, gospel music, and R&B. She has performed on Broadway as well as in the Democratic National Convention and in clubs and festivals throughout Europe. Sunshine Her real name has been given as Denise White. Though she's located in Atlanta however, her roots lie located in Chester Pennsylvania. There she started to pursue the musical profession by singing and playing the piano at church. She studied at Spellman College and began to master the R&B style of Atlanta. In 2005, she was employed as the primary keyboardist in Tyler Perry's stage show Meet the Browns. Jennifer Holliday was the Grammy and Tony Award winner who approached her in 2007 to serve as the director of chorus for Dreamgirls, the theatre production at Atlanta's National Black Arts Festival. Sunshine gained national recognition during her four daily performances during 2008's Democratic National Convention. She was invited to perform at President Barack Obama's 2008 inauguration.
